“I want to express my concern about the increasing encroachment of Black Friday on Thanksgiving Day itself. Stores are opening earlier and earlier on Thursday, denying employees the opportunity for one unencumbered day of respite. The sad effect of this gross piece of consumerism is to say to us all: `you don’t have enough’ — on a day when we are called to be thankful for what we do have. Can’t the sale be resisted, and the shopping spree put off at least until dawn on Friday? The stores only do this if consumers support it.”

– Chip Stokes, Bishop, Episcopal Diocese of New Jersey
